中转 API 使用教程
常见问题
Claude Code

Claude Code 相关问题


如何在 VSCode CC 插件中使用玖亿AI

Windows

  1. 确保你已完成 环境检查 并保证 Claude Code CLI 没问题。如有问题,请按照 Claude Code 配置教程 先完成 CLI 配置。

  2. 键盘按下 Win + R,输入以下内容后回车,打开 Claude Code 配置目录:

    %userprofile%\.claude
  3. 目录内容如图所示。如果目录中没有 config.json,需要手动创建后打开。

    • config.json:用来配置 VSCode 的 Claude Code 插件的一些行为
  4. config.json 中写入以下内容后保存:

    {
      "primaryApiKey": "玖亿AI"
    }
  5. 重启 VSCode,开始愉快使用吧!

macOS

  1. 确保你已完成 环境检查 并保证 Claude Code CLI 没问题。

  2. 在访达界面按下 Command + Shift + G,输入以下路径后回车,打开配置目录:

    ~/.claude
  3. 目录内容如图所示。如果目录中没有 config.json,需要手动创建后打开。

  4. config.json 中写入以下内容后保存:

    {
      "primaryApiKey": "玖亿AI"
    }
  5. 重启 VSCode,开始愉快使用吧!


Claude Code 中常用命令

命令功能说明
claude在当前目录启动交互式 REPL,对话式使用 Claude Code
claude "解释这个项目"启动 REPL 并带上初始问题,一进来就让 Claude 分析项目
claude -p "解释这个函数"使用 print 模式一次性问答,输出结果后直接退出,便于脚本 / CI 调用
cat logs.txt | claude -p "帮我总结错误"将文件或命令输出通过管道喂给 Claude,再配合 -p 做总结、分析
claude -c继续当前目录最近的一次会话,在原有上下文里接着聊
claude -c -p "检查类型错误"在最近会话上下文中执行一次性请求,常用于自动化检查
claude -r "abc123" "把这个 PR 完成"通过会话 ID 恢复指定会话,并继续执行新任务
claude update将 Claude Code CLI 更新到最新版本
claude mcp管理和配置 MCP 服务器,让 Claude 能访问外部数据源和工具
claude --add-dir ../apps ../lib为 Claude 额外添加可访问的代码目录,支持跨多个路径读代码
claude --agents '{"reviewer":{...}}'通过 JSON 临时定义子 Agent,例如 code-reviewer、debugger 等
claude -p "生成接口文档" --output-format json使用 JSON 格式输出回答,方便后续脚本解析处理
claude --model sonnet指定会话使用的模型(如 sonnet / opus 或具体模型名)
claude --verbose打开详细日志,显示工具调用和内部步骤,便于调试
claude --resume abc123 "继续修这个 Bug"通过会话 ID 恢复会话,在任意目录继续之前的工作
claude --continue载入当前目录最近的一次会话,相当于"继续上次对话"
claude --append-system-prompt "始终使用 TypeScript"在默认系统提示后追加自定义规则,不影响默认行为
claude --dangerously-skip-permissions跳过权限确认,让 Claude 自动执行读写文件 / 运行命令(⚠️ 高风险,仅在完全信任环境使用)

Claude Code 无法连接到 Anthropic 服务

📌 注意事项:如果你是首次配置、根据链接跳转到这一步,直接按照下面教程运行命令即可。

使用 npm 安装完 claude 之后,在命令行输入 claude 报了如下错误:

Unable to connect to Anthropic services
Failed to connect to api.anthropic.com: ERR BAD REQUEST
Please check your internet connection and network settings.
Note: Claude Code might not be available in your country, Check supported countries at
https://anthropic.com/supported-countries
连接失败错误

或是在初次配置时出现以下问题:

onboarding 错误

Windows 解决方案

  1. 按下键盘 Win + R,输入 cmd 后回车,打开命令行程序

  2. 在命令行中运行以下命令后回车:

    powershell -Command "$f='%USERPROFILE%\.claude.json';$j=Get-Content $f|ConvertFrom-Json;$j|Add-Member -NotePropertyName 'hasCompletedOnboarding' -NotePropertyValue $true -Force;$j|ConvertTo-Json|Set-Content $f"
  3. 重启你的 Claude CLI

macOS 解决方案

  1. 在 App 列表中找到 终端 程序,点击运行

    macOS 终端
  2. 在终端中运行以下命令后回车:

    jq '. + {"hasCompletedOnboarding": true}' ~/.claude.json > /tmp/tmp.json && mv /tmp/tmp.json ~/.claude.json

    💡 如果提示"未找到 jq",可以先输入 brew install jq 进行安装。

  3. 重启你的 Claude CLI


Claude Code 如何切换回 200K 上下文并禁用非必要流量

如果你希望将 Claude Code 从 1M 上下文 切换回 200K 上下文,并关闭一些非必要请求与终端标题变更,可以在 settings.jsonenv 中加入以下配置。

Windows

  1. 按下键盘 Win + R,输入以下内容后回车:

    %userprofile%\.claude
  2. 打开或创建 settings.json

  3. 确认 env 中包含以下内容:

    {
      "env": {
        "CLAUDE_CODE_DISABLE_1M_CONTEXT": "1",
        "CLAUDE_CODE_DISABLE_NONESSENTIAL_TRAFFIC": "1",
        "CLAUDE_CODE_DISABLE_TERMINAL_TITLE": "1"
      }
    }

macOS

  1. 在访达中按下 Command + Shift + G,输入以下路径后回车:

    ~/.claude
  2. 打开或创建 settings.json

  3. 确认 env 中包含以下内容:

    {
      "env": {
        "CLAUDE_CODE_DISABLE_1M_CONTEXT": "1",
        "CLAUDE_CODE_DISABLE_NONESSENTIAL_TRAFFIC": "1",
        "CLAUDE_CODE_DISABLE_TERMINAL_TITLE": "1"
      }
    }